Documentation on MQL5: Constants, Enumerations and Structures / Indicator Constants / Indicators Lines
Documentation on MQL5: Constants, Enumerations and Structures / Indicator Constants / Indicators Lines
  • www.mql5.com
Some technical indicators have several buffers drawn in the chart. Numbering of indicator buffers starts with 0. When copying indicator values using the CopyBuffer() function into an array of the double type, for some indicators one may indicate the identifier of a copied buffer instead of its number.

What is the error number that you are getting?
 
  if(CopyBuffer(SlowMovingAverageDefinition,3,0,3,SlowMovingAveragearray)<0 || CopyBuffer(FastMovingAverageDefinition,4,0,3,FastMovingAveragearray)<0 )
     {
      Alert("Error copying Moving Average indicator buffer - error:",GetLastError());
      ResetLastError();
      return;
     }


what are these numbers supposed to be? 
they should be the buffer number you want from iMA  which only has one so should be 0
this will resolve your issue with error 4806
